Hello all,

I am new in working with LabView and NI. That ´s why I need a bit help with the package installation.

 

I have a project,which developed at Win7,some older version of LabView and uses Chasis cRIO-9024 with NI 9401,NI 9237, NI 9871. I want to run this project with the same Chasis at WIN10 and LabView 19.

I´ve installed:

LabView 19

LabView FPGA Module

LabView Real Time 19

(You can see the all other installed Drivers and Packages in the screen shots).

 

The Problem is that the NI 9401,NI 9237 and NI 9871 are not recognized and even when I start a new project I can´t see any FPGA´s.

Your cRIO-9024 is a rather old legacy device. It uses VxWorks as operating system. NI discontinued support for VxWorks based targets in NI-CompactRIO 20.0 and later. Since you installed CompactRIO 21.0, your computer simply has no support to communicate with your hardware.

 

You need to install CompactRIO 19.0 at least (to support your LabVIEW 2019 installation) and CompactRIO 19.6 at most (to support your VxWorks target).

 

Do NOT upgrade to any newer LabVIEW version than 2019 SP1. The CompactRIO drivers need to be at least the same version (or at most 3 higher versions) than your LabVIEW version to have support for your LabVIEW installation. But CompactRIO 20.0 and higher does not support your hardware anymore.
